Understanding the Mechanics of The Painful Reality Of A Dislocated Knee: 4-6 Weeks To Full Recovery

A dislocated knee is a type of orthopedic injury that occurs when the bones in the knee joint are misaligned or out of place. This can happen due to trauma, such as a fall or a sports injury, or as a result of a sudden twisting motion. When the knee is dislocated, the surrounding soft tissues, including ligaments, tendons, and muscles, become stretched or torn, leading to pain, swelling, and instability.

The Anatomy of a Dislocated Knee:

The knee joint is a complex structure composed of bones, ligaments, tendons, and muscles. The thigh bone (femur) and the shin bone (tibia) form the joint, which is stabilized by four ligaments: the anterior cruciate ligament (ACL), the posterior cruciate ligament (PCL), the medial collateral ligament (MCL), and the lateral collateral ligament (LCL). When a dislocation occurs, one or more of these ligaments may be torn or stretched, leading to a loss of function and stability in the knee.
